Guidelines for Entering Information
The following section explains how to enter user information into the
MultiPASS C20.
N
If you pause while entering information and do not make an entry
for more than 60 seconds, the MultiPASS C20 returns to standby
mode and loses all information you had entered up to that point.
You will then have to start again.

Entering a Name
To enter a name (such as "Unit Name"), use the numeric buttons. Each
numeric button has a number and a group of uppercase and lowercase
letters assigned to it. The chart below shows which number to press for
each character.
